The answer to that question is simple. With their entertaining, unique lyrics, and creative ability to always keep us wanting more, they have outdone themselves once again with a rendition of Metallica’s “Enter Sandman.”
This version will soon be available for purchase on the new album, “The Metallica Blacklist” where you can hear over 50 artists sing their versions of songs off Metallica’s 1991 self-titled album.
If there was a band you didn’t know you needed to hear remake “Enter Sandman,” it is Weezer. Is Rivers Cuomo another James Hetfield? No, but does he need to be? (Side note: Hetfield went to my high school and we always used to look up his photo in the old yearbooks in the school library.)
Weezer brings something special to this song, including a very quick homage to their super mega hit, “Buddy Holly.” You know these guys don’t take themselves too seriously, but they are serious rockers no matter what song they are playing!
You can check out this and other artists on, “The Metallica Blacklist” on digital and streaming platforms September 10th and vinyl and CD on October 1st.
